Visual Indicators of Termite Problem



If you notice tiny piles of what looks like sawdust near wood structures in your house, you may be seeing the very first visual indications of a termite infestation. Termites, frequently referred to as the 'quiet destroyers,' can wreak havoc on your residential or commercial property without you even realizing it. These tiny heaps are in fact termite droppings, referred to as frass, which are a byproduct of their tunneling tasks within the wood.

As you check your home for indicators of termites, pay close attention to any type of mud tubes running along the walls or foundation. These tubes act as protective passages for termites to take a trip between their nest and a food resource without drying out. In addition, watch out for any type of bubbling or peeling paint, as this might indicate wetness accumulation caused by termite activity within the walls.

To additionally verify a termite invasion, try to find hollow-sounding timber when tapped and look for any discarded wings near windowsills or door structures. Taking timely activity upon observing these aesthetic indications can aid prevent extensive damages to your home.

Structural Adjustments Caused by Termites



Pay attention carefully for any kind of signs of hollow-sounding or weakened wood in your home, as these structural adjustments might show a termite invasion. Termites feed upon timber from the inside out, leaving a slim veneer of timber or paint on the surface while hollowing out the within. This can result in timber that sounds hollow when touched or feels soft and deteriorated.

Furthermore, you may notice bending or sagging floors, doors that no longer close correctly, or home windows that are suddenly hard to open. These adjustments occur as termites harm the structural integrity of wood elements in your home. Watch out for tiny holes in timber, as these could be termite departure factors where they push out fecal pellets.

If you observe any one of these architectural modifications, it's vital to act without delay and look for professional help to examine and address a possible termite problem prior to it creates additional damages to your home.
